Superficially, Dotson and Addison seem similar to me as slight WRs who can play the position. They can be effective and productive (like Dotson showed last year)but I don't see them as a WR1 either for the NFL or fantasy.

Re: J Addison vs J Dotson
Addison is a better prospect and I didnt have a 1st round grade on Dotson either.
Addison broke out as a freshman and dominated his SO year with 100/1500. It took Addison until his Jr year to break out and he did not declare until after his 4th year.
Dotson is a bit more athletic, but Addison wins with better routes.
Their situations are both as WR2s on their NFL teams, but I think Addison has a better shot at hitting WR2 #s in fantasy, just maybe not this year as he's a rookie.

Re: J Addison vs J Dotson
I thought Dotson was the better player, but like Addison, too. I was not surprised at all that Dotson went in round 1, I felt he was one of the best WR's in last years class, and I am a lot more confident in his play strength and contested catch ability than Addison, and he can also separate.
